Hike the easy 0.7-mile Bluff Creek Trail in Emmenegger Nature Park, gaining 9 feet of elevation in just 16 minutes.

The Bluff Creek Trail is quite short and easy. Most hikers can complete it in about 15-20 minutes, making it perfect for a quick stroll or a leisurely walk through nature.
Yes, absolutely! This trail is rated as easy, with minimal elevation changes, making it ideal for beginners, families with young children, and anyone looking for a relaxed outdoor experience.
The terrain is generally flat with very little elevation gain or loss. You'll find a well-maintained path, likely dirt or gravel, winding through the natural surroundings of Emmenegger Nature Park.
The trail is located within Emmenegger Nature Park. You can typically find parking available at the park's main entrance or designated parking areas, which provide direct access to the trail.
Generally, nature parks like Emmenegger allow dogs, but they must be kept on a leash at all times to protect wildlife and ensure a pleasant experience for all visitors. Please check local signage for specific regulations.
The trail is enjoyable year-round. Spring offers lush greenery and blooming wildflowers, while autumn provides beautiful fall foliage. Summer is pleasant for early morning or late afternoon walks, and even winter can be serene, especially after a light snowfall.
Access to Emmenegger Nature Park and the Bluff Creek Trail is typically free, and no permits are usually required for day hiking. However, it's always a good idea to check the park's official website for any updates on fees or regulations.
As the trail is located in a forest setting within Emmenegger Nature Park, you can expect to see various native trees, shrubs, and wildflowers. Keep an eye out for common forest birds, squirrels, and other small woodland creatures.
Yes, while the Bluff Creek Trail itself covers 100% of this route, it also intersects with sections of the Meremec Greenway for about 7% of its length, offering options for longer walks if you wish to explore further.
Given its short length and easy difficulty, you won't need much. Comfortable walking shoes, a water bottle, and perhaps a light jacket depending on the weather are usually sufficient. Don't forget your camera to capture the natural beauty!
Visitors to Emmenegger Nature Park are generally asked to stay on marked trails, pack out all trash, and respect the natural environment. Dogs must be leashed, and disturbing wildlife or plants is prohibited. Always check park signage for the most current rules.
